"Tired but happy, sorry for the injured". Lara Gut-Behrami and the third super-g cup

With second place behind Brignone in the last race at Passo San Pellegrino, the Swiss champion has already brought home another crystal ball. And in general there are almost 200 margin points on Vlhova ...

A second place that counts as a victory. Every so often you have to settle, even if your name is Lara Gut-Behrami and you have just returned from five consecutive victories in the discipline; the super-g that closed the three days of the historic debut of Val di Fassa in the World Cup is worth the third crystal ball in its favorite specialty, after those of 2014 and 2016. Almost a formality, even if today Federica Brignone also made a difference on the Ticino, who can smile all right for another 80 points earned on Petra Vlhova in general. He says not to think about it, but meanwhile Lara is 187 points ahead of the Slovak, who will now have four technical races (including three slalom) to shorten before the finals in Lenzerheide. "Today I struggled more - admitted Gut-Behrami to RSI microphones - I couldn't really enter the race, the tiredness made itself felt like everyone else, they were really busy days and I can't wait to be able to go home a couple of days. At the end of the season it is a great stress, even mental, and we are sorry to see athletes who get hurt as happened today. It really takes a moment to compromise everything, especially in this condition of consecutive races ”.
